Security Forces (SFs) recovered a cache of arms and ammunition near the Line of Control (LoC) in Mendhar tehsil (revenue unit) in Poonch District of Jammu and Kashmir (J&K) in India on January 3, reports Daily Excelsior. This was the third round of recovery of arms and ammunition in the District following the busting of a three-member module of Jammu and Kashmir Ghaznavi Force (JKGF). Senior Superintendent of Police (SSP), Poonch, Ramesh Angral said, the fresh recovery has been made during a search and cordon operation from Dabbi village along the LoC in Balakote sector of Mendhar. The recovery includes one pistol, three magazines, 35 bullets and five hand grenades, he said. Three militant associates were arrested in Balakote area on December 27 and six hand grenades were recovered from them. Earlier, SATP had reported, Poonch Police and Army foiled a major plot by the militants to trigger communal tension in Poonch District of J&K in India on December 27, with arrest of three militants of newly floated JK Ghaznavi Force in Mendhar area who were planning to target religious places of minorities starting with famous temple of Ari.
